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: Children age 1-15 years who will undergo tendon surgery (such as Achilles tendon tenotomy, hamstring tenotomy, adductor tenotomy and tendon transfer) No previous pain before operation
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: History of drug allergy to bupivacaine, ketorolac, morphine, paracetamol and ibuprofen History of bleeding disorder History of abnormal kidney function
